What does the manipulation tool enable in a design application?

The manipulation tool in a design application is primarily designed to enhance the user’s ability to interact with objects in the workspace. It facilitates the dragging of icons or objects for real-time viewing of changes in design, allowing users to adjust the placement, orientation, or size of elements effectively. This real-time manipulation helps in visualizing how changes impact the overall design without needing to execute commands separately.

In practice, being able to drag and drop elements is essential for dynamic design workflows where adjustments are frequently made, enabling designers to see the immediate effects of their manipulations. This tool is integral at various stages of the design process, especially during the layout configuration and spatial arrangement of components.
